Ampullifera

Translingual

Etymology

From Latin ampulla (ampulla) +‎ Latin -fera (-bearing).

Coined by botanist and mycologist Frederick Claude Deighton in 1960.

Pronunciation

  • English:
    • (US) IPA(key): /ˌæm.pəˈlɪ.fɚ.ɹə/, /ˌæm.pjʊˈlɪ.fɚ.ɹə/

Proper noun

Ampullifera f

  1. A taxonomic genus within the class Dothideomycetes – certain fungi.
